Indian Recipes

The Indian recipe is usually unique and distinct in terms of usage of spices in preparing the food. The method of preparation of Indian food depends on the region or culture of where the food originates from. Indian food basically consists of a wide range of pulses, rice, pickles, vegetables and rotis. The main ingredients used as well as the flavors vary depending on the culture of the people.

The south Indian recipes are well known for their delicious idlis and dosas while the north Indian recipes are popular for their typical gravies, tandoori chicken and kulchas. The western Indian recipe is completely different and unique with fish, rice as well as the use of coconut being some of the most significant items. The eastern Indian recipes on the other hand are popular for their wide range mouthwatering sweets.

Spicing forms a very important factor when it comes to flavoring, spices basically add aroma to the flavor which is felt even when cooking. This is often used as a basis of constructing the appetite. Desserts usually contain spices like cardamom or cinnamon that adds a definite and unique taste as well as aiding in digestion.

Many of the Indian recipes are not only delicious but also of great health benefits. A good example is turmeric which is a very important Indian spice. Turmeric is used to bring in flavor and taste to the dish. You will find it very common in most of the Indian dishes.

Who doesn’t love chilies? You will find a lot of chilies in the Indian recipe. Chilies are supposedly the hottest spices on the planet. They are available in fresh and powdery form. Chilies are used as additives in the Indian recipe and are meant to bring in flavor and taste. The hotness of the chili brings in a tongue tingling effect with a unique kind of sweetness.
